This dog intelligence test for man's best friend is designed such that if many animals are checked, the distribution of the scores resembles a normal distribution with a mean (average dog IQ) of 100 and a standard deviation of 15. However, there a few simple activities you can do with your cat to see how intelligent she is. Some dogs are simply faster problem-solvers than others, but you also have to consider the age of your dogs, since an older dog may be a bit slower than a fully-functioning pup.
